HTML content can be minified and compressed by a website’s server. The most efficient way is to compress content using GZIP which reduces data amount travelling through the network between server and browser. Changing it to UTF-8 can be a good choice, as this format is commonly used for encoding all over the web and thus their visitors won’t have any troubles with symbol transcription or reading.

Lack of Open Graph description can be counter-productive for their social media presence, as such a description allows converting a website homepage (or other pages) into good-looking, rich and well-structured posts, when it is being shared on Facebook and other social media.
